Q: What is the Form AID-LI-ANF?
A: Form AID-LI-ANF is the Assumed Business Name Filing Form in Arkansas.
Q: What is an assumed business name?
A: An assumed business name is a name under which a business operates that is different from the owner's legal name.
Q: Why do I need to file an assumed business name?
A: Filing an assumed business name allows the public to easily identify the owner of a business operating under a different name.
Q: Who needs to file the Form AID-LI-ANF?
A: Any individual or business entity that wants to operate under an assumed business name in Arkansas needs to file this form.
